Not being one to open up and leave the readers hanging *cough*SCW*cough*, I decided to show off the "Jet Mecha" which I ordered alongside. I was not really fond of the twin MGs in the chin, so I moved them to the arms (which had a useful hole there) and added a Funkmessgerät radar thingie in their place (plus a searchlight which I think I will cover in plastic).
For the paint scheme, I went for the early war splinter scheme, slightly modified for two colors (Vallejo Military Green and German Grey) plus some metallised areas. The pilot was done in Luftwaffe Blue uniform. After much cursing, I gave up trying to fit a completely glazed canopy, so I settled for an "half open" look similar to the practice of US dive bomber pilots in the Pacific theatre.
Decals come off a Dragon E-100 kit in 1/72nd scale.
